CTD Tiles Livingston

Claim Listing
Unit 3B New Houston Business Park Livingston EH54 5BZ United Kingdom

Reviews


To write a review, you must login first.

SIMILAR LISTING


CTD Tiles Lincoln

CTD Tiles Leeds

CTD Tiles King's Lynn

CTD Tiles Kilmarnock

Admin